Abstract

A power supply circuit and an apparatus includes: a first switching transistor, a second switching transistor, a third switching transistor, a fourth switching transistor, a first capacitor, and a second capacitor. In this power supply circuit, one terminal of the first capacitor is connected to one terminal of the second capacitor, the other terminal of the first capacitor is separately connected to a first electrode of the first switching transistor and a first electrode of the second switching transistor, a second electrode of the first switching transistor is connected to a second electrode of the third switching transistor, a second electrode of the second switching transistor is connected to a second electrode of the fourth switching transistor, a third electrode of the first switching transistor is connected to an output node, and a third electrode of the second switching transistor is grounded.
